Abstract

Symmetric and unsymmetric carbocyanines derived from 2,2-difluoro-3,1,2-(2H)-oxaoxoniaboratines have been synthesized which contain the polymethylene bridge groups (CH2)n (n = 1, 2, 3) in the chromophore. As shown, these groups acting as electron-donor substituents deepen the dye colour according to the Foerster–Dewar–Knott rule. The enhanced steric hindrances caused by them give rise to the broken planarity of the dye molecules. The 1H NMR chemical shifts for the protons at the meso-position of the chromophore have been correlated with the π-charges on the corresponding carbon atoms calculated by the Pariser–Parr–Pople method.
